JK Rowling's alter ego 'Robert Galbraith' makes longlist for crime-writing prize

Award winning author JK Rowling's alter ego Roberth Galbraith makes the longlist for the Theakston Old Peculier Crime Novel of the year for debut novelist and stalwarts in the genre for a crime-writing prize.

The Harry Potter series author, who wrote Career of Evil under the pseudonym 'Robert Galbraith', is featured on the longlist for this year's prize.

The longlist, which comprises 18 titles, was selected by an academy of crime-writing authors, agents, editors, reviewers, members of the Theakstons Old Peculier Crime Writing Festival programming committee and representatives from T&R Theakston Ltd and WHSmith.


The 12th Theakstons Old Peculier Crime Novel of the Year award is open to crime authors whose novels were published in paperback from May 1 2015 to April 18 2016.

The shortlist of six titles will be announced on May 31 and the overall winner will be decided by the panel of judges and a public vote.

The winner will be announced at an award ceremony on July 21 on the opening night of the 14th Theakstons Old Peculier Crime Writing Festival in Harrogate.
